    Document: A serious problem for using ssRNA as a genome is the formation of double-stranded RNA (dsRNA), which occurs during replication. For recursive replication, an ss-RNA genome must replicate as a single strand; however, the proximity of the newly synthesized strand to the template genome at replication would lead to formation of dsRNA through hybridization. This dsRNA formation is a problem for recursive replication in the RNA world (3) and is one of the most serious problems in the reconstitution of a replication system of an artificial ssRNA genome (4, 5) .
